How am I able to replace RF inductor coil(s) [the ones that have that wax
covering over them to keep "sticky fingers" from turning them with another
one that will work.

snip


Search the net for a program called "HAMCALC" by VE3ERP. It has a coil
designer program plus a jillion other nifty things, and lots of other
very useful info.
